Pat Spencer shines in clutch despite loss
by Bruno Mulé | Warriors Correspondent | Fri, Dec 5th 11:01am EST
With Stephen Curry and Jimmy Butler unavailable, Pat Spencer has emerged as a viable deep-league streaming option, a status he reinforced with a strong performance in Thursday's loss to the 76ers. The two-way guard finished with 16 points on efficient 5-of-8 shooting, adding four rebounds, four assists, one steal, and two three-pointers.
Fantasy Impact:
Spencer nearly played the hero for Golden State, knocking down a go-ahead triple with 1:12 remaining to give his team a four-point cushion before Philadelphia closed the game on a 5-0 run. This effort comes on the heels of a career-high scoring performance against the Thunder on Tuesday, suggesting he could continue to hold value for the final two games of the Warriors' road trip.
